As #CFCU18 manager, Jody Morris' teams won every competition they entered over his two seasons in charge. A treble in 16-17, a quadruple in 2017-18.

59 wins, 9 draws, 5 defeats, 223 goals, 57 conceded, 41 clean sheets.

ALWAYS Chelsea. Best of luck at Derby @morriskid. ? ?

It's a great record and I'm sure he is an excellent coach, however I don't think we should get overly excited yet. 

Chelsea collect talented youngsters like I used to collect panini stickers. Look at how many they have out on loan.

Whilst they would look to appoint a talented coach, an u18 academy coach is not in charge of youth recruitment. 

Hopefully he will be a good appointment but we have little evidence to suggest he will be exceptional.
